Posted on: 18/07/2025
About This Position
If you have a strong background in Node.js development and are proficient with related technologies, we want to hear from you!
What are you going to do ?
- Develop and maintain RESTful or GraphQL APIs using Node.js (Express/NestJS/Koa).
- Design and implement scalable, reliable, and secure backend services.
- Integrate with third-party services and databases (SQL and NoSQL).
- Write clean, well-documented, and efficient code and ensure code quality through code reviews, unit testing, and integration testing.
- Lead code reviews and provide technical guidance to team members.
- Participate in architectural design and decision-making.
- Ensure performance, quality, and responsiveness of applications.
- Work closely with product managers, designers, and other developers to understand requirements and deliver high-quality software solutions.
- Implement best practices in security, testing, and CI/CD.
- Monitor and maintain applications post-deployment to ensure optimal performance and reliability.
You Need To Have :
- 3+ years of professional experience in Node.js development.
- Proven track record of designing, developing, and deploying scalable software applications.
- Bachelors degree in Computer Science, Engineering, or a related field.
- Strong proficiency in Node.js and JavaScript (ES6+).
- Experience with related technologies and frameworks (e.g., Express, Koa, NestJS).
- Experience with databases (SQL and NoSQL) and data modeling.
- Proficient in using version control systems, particularly Git.
- Familiarity with containerization technologies like Docker.
- Experience with cloud platforms (e.g., AWS, Azure, Google Cloud) and deployment processes.
- Understanding of RESTful APIs, WebSockets, and microservices architecture.
- Knowledge of testing frameworks and tools (e.g., Mocha, Chai, Jest) is a plus.
Did you find something suspicious?
Posted By
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1515566
Interview Questions for you
View All